Fidelity NASDAQ Composite Index ETF (ONEQ) belongs to the US All Cap segment. American Century U.S. Quality Growth ETF (QGRO) is part of the US Multi-Factor segment. ONEQ's top 3 sector exposures are Technology, Consumer Non-Cyclicals and Healthcare. In contrast, QGRO's top sector exposures are Technology, Industrials and Healthcare. ONEQ is less exp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 0.21%, versus 0.29% for QGRO. ONEQ is up 8.6% year-to-date (YTD) with +$184M in YTD flows. Frequently asked questions about ONEQ and QGRO

How have the ONEQ and QGRO ETFs performed in 2026?

As of July 30, 2026, ONEQ is up 8.6% year-to-date (YTD), while QGRO has lost -0.35%. That puts ONEQ better performer ahead so far this year.

Which ETF is attracting more investor money: ONEQ or QGRO?

Year-to-date, the ONEQ ETF saw +$184M in flows, compared to -$290M for QGRO.

Which ETF is more volatile: ONEQ or QGRO?

Over the past year, ONEQ had a volatility of 18.43%, while QGRO experienced 16.17%.

Which ETF is bigger: ONEQ or QGRO?

As of July 30, 2026, ONEQ holds $10.27 B in assets under management (AUM), while QGRO manages $1.95 B.

What sectors do the ONEQ and QGRO ETFs invest in?

ONEQ leans toward sectors like Technology and Consumer Non-Cyclicals. Meanwhile, QGRO focuses on Technology, Industrials and Healthcare.

What are the top holdings of the ONEQ ETF and QGRO ETF?

ONEQ top holdings include NVIDIA Corp., Apple, Inc. and Microsoft Corp.. QGRO holds in its top three: Lam Research Corp., Eli Lilly & Co. and Apple, Inc..

Which ETF is more diversified: ONEQ or QGRO?

ONEQ holds 998 securities with 62.63% of its assets in the top 15. QGRO has 187 securities and a top 15 weight of 39.23%.
